:mad HELLLLLLLP asap php problem

im setting up a script i bought autorankproPHP
im getting this error
Error PHP is running in safe mode.
From /home/virtual/site1/fst/var/www/html/AutoRankPHP/common.php line 4


what the hell does php running in safe mode mean?????

If you are on shared hosting that's possible.. It's off by default. That option tries to make php executions more secure by not allowing system commands or limiting them to a special folder only.
